New self check-in kiosks at "Chopin Airport" in Warsaw

Warsaw, Poland - 15 have been installed, available to passengers flying with seven airlines

Now, including the older-generation facilities, "Chopin Airport" in Warsaw offers as many as 23 self check-in kiosks. All belong to the airport and have been purchased to meet the needs of airlines and keep up with global trends in passenger check-in technologies. All of the new self check-in kiosks have card readers, as well as barcode and document scanners, allowing passengers to check-in smoothly,...
